Blurb
Our first meeting as neighbors was screwed from the start.
He was hot. I was naked. And we had no chance in hell at ever being platonic.
I’ll be the first to admit that I live at extremes. After going ten years locked in what felt like a dysfunctional marriage, I’m now decidedly boy-free. In nearly three years I’ve had no boyfriends, no flings, no dates and no sex. For the sake of my dream career, the sacrifice has been easy.
At least it was.
Until Lukas came along.
He’s rude, gorgeous, arrogant – a stone-carved wall of muscle and distraction. He’s everything I know to avoid but there’s no avoiding your next-door neighbor. Oh yeah. The man now lives three steps from me and to make matters worse, he crashed into my life while I was soaked in the tub. Mortifying to say the least and it went something like this: I ran out exposed. He looked. He laughed.
And then I locked myself out.
In short, Lukas Hendricks was smirking, swaggering trouble from the start. And me?

Review
This book was AWESOME, the story of Lukas and Lia is amazing. The author has such deep character development that happens in this book, and really you can feel them growing as a person. Lukas, the rich self-made man is a womanizing man whore, until he comes across Lia. I don't want to say how because it is part of the plot.
Lia grew up in upstate New York, and moved to the city when life took a nose dive. When she comes across Lukas, she is totally opposed to anything and everything to do with him. She like the nice orderly life she has made for herself, and she has no intention of straying from her path.
Life has a funny way of kicking you in the perverbial balls, just when you think you have your shit it order, fate is like..."not today motherfucker" and things happen, and life changes at a whim. The author has a knack for making the reader feel a part of the story, not just a vouyer. This story is told in first person alternating views.

Author Bio
Stella Rhys is an author of contemporary romance and can't help but write it hot, steamy and borderline filthy (just kidding, it's flat-out filthy). Writing aside, she lives for coffee, the Yankees and cooking recipes way out of her league. She was born and raised in New York and now lives there with her husband and charmingly entitled fur baby.
